Nigerian afrobeats singer Raoul John Njeng-Njeng, popularly known as Skales, has spoken to youths about staying in the country, fueling the migration agenda.

The artist, while speaking via his X handle, claimed that leaving the country would allow young Nigerians to achieve their goals. Skales spoke about the state of security in the country, pointing it out as another important reasons why youths should aspire to leave Nigeria.

“As a young Nigerian, your biggest dream should be to leave Nigeria so you can survive and actually achieve your dream by at least staying alive,” he wrote.

his post stirred mixed reactions from supporters and opposers. some berated him for supporting the agenda rather than urging youths to hold their leaders accountable.
